We've released the Agents SDK ↗, a package and set of tools that help you build and ship AI Agents.
You can get up and running with a chat-based AI Agent ↗ (and deploy it to Workers) that uses the Agents SDK, tool calling, and state syncing with a React-based front-end by running the following command:
npm create cloudflare@latest agents-starter -- --template="cloudflare/agents-starter"
# open up README.md and follow the instructions
You can also add an Agent to any existing Workers application by installing the agents package directly
npm i agents
... and then define your first Agent:
import { Agent } from "agents";
export class YourAgent extends Agent<Env> {
// Build it out
// Access state on this.state or query the Agent's database via this.sql
// Handle WebSocket events with onConnect and onMessage
// Run tasks on a schedule with this.schedule
// Call AI models
// ... and/or call other Agents.
}
